Long-Term Drug Rehab in Jamaica, Iowa
Long-term drug rehab in Jamaica is a facility that provides rehabilitation for not less than ninety, but as long as 3 to 5 months in some cases depending on the center of preference. Long-term drug rehabs in Jamaica, Iowa are the preferred option if this option can be chosen, because success rates prove that people reap the rewards of the level of treatment and exclusive setting offered in long-term facilities. Facilities which offer short-term rehabilitation, 30 days or fewer, are typically only able to help those overcome physical hurdles when they initially stop using alcohol. This is only the beginning of the process, and individuals who only go so far as to address physical issues have a similar chance of relapsing as somebody who never managed to get into rehab. Nobody should risk this occurring to them, particularly if they put in the effort to get in to treatment and want this to be a successful and fruitful experience. The final purpose is always to keep sustain the abstinence they achieve in rehabilitation, so individuals should steel themselves for what may be needed to do this which won't be easy or fast. Within a long-term drug rehab in Jamaica, IA., this usually entails a concerted effort from treatment professionals and willing rehab clients to address any concerns in the individual's life which could jeopardize their sobriety and their hopes of a brighter and happier future. Important lifestyle changes will be made and all of these changes will guarantee the person has the best chance at staying drug free.
